Today would have been rhythm and blues legend Otis Redding's 79th birthday. When he died in a plane crash on December 10, 1967, in Madison, Wisconsin's Lake Monona, he had just recorded what would be his signature song, "(Sittin' On) The Dock Of The Bay," three days earlier at the Stax recording studio in Memphis, Tennessee. The song became the first number one record released posthumously, and was Redding's biggest hit.
